Conditions

Investigating the effect of ovarian rexosome injection derived from allograft menstrual blood mesenchyme cells on infertility in pcos patiens. IV Endocrine, nutritional and metabolic diseases

Interventions

Intervention 1: Intervention group: 11 PCOS patients undergoing intraovarian injection of exosome in the follicular phase. Intervention 2: Control group: 11 PCOS patients without intraovarian injectio

Eligibility

Sex/Gender
Female
Age
20 Years to 40 Years

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: PCOS patients Normal Sperm analysis Age 20 to 40 years BMI=28-32, BMI <28 Kg/m2 Normal uterine on hysterosalpingography or sonography History of unsuccessful IVF

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: Active infection Active cancer Chronic multi-organ failure Diabetes Pregnancy Previous member link Patients with positive diagnosis of hepatitis A, B, C and HIV Abnormal uterine shape on hysterosalpingography or hysteroscopy Blood or immunological diseases Chromosomal and genetic abnormalities (acquired or congenital) Successful pregnancy history Cushing's syndrome Uncontrolled thyroid dysfunction (hypothyroidism and hyperthyroidism)

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
Egg (Oocyte) number. Timepoint: Before injection and two months after injection. Method of measurement: Number of egg formed in the IVF cycle before injection and two months later.;Egg (Oocyte) quality. Timepoint: Before injection and two months after injection. Method of measurement: Based on embryological criteria (metaphase 1 and 2 and germinal vesicle).;Embryo number. Timepoint: Before injection and two months after injection. Method of measurement: Number of embryos formed in the IVF cycle before injection and two months later.;Embryo quality. Timepoint: Before injection and two months after injection. Method of measurement: Grade A, B, C, D based on embryological criteria.
